RESTInTag
A JavaScript plugin to ease the HTTP requests by making them work directly from the HTML tags. it was inspired by RestfulizerJs by Ifnot but with a different implementation.

Usage
easy! just add the following attributes to your HTML tag:
data-method
: the request type, GET, POST, PUT, etc.data-target
: the url to send/get the datadata-disabled
:true
to disable the tag until the request is done else just putfalse
data-once
:true
to disable the tag entirely after the first request, default isfalse

API
Options
First you need to set your options, here's the available options (the seen values are the default):
async: true // if set to false calls will be synchronous parse: false // if you have query string, it will add them to the request body target: null // the url method: "GET" // the request method headers: {} // the HTTP headers timeout: 0 // milliseconds to wait before cancelling the request, 0 means no timeout data: {} // request body specially for POST and PUT requests disable: true // to disable the clicking event until the request is finished once: false // to disable the click event after the first request is processed

Browser Support
Both jQuery version and Vanilla version support the following browsers:
- Chrome (Latest)
- FireFox (Latest)
- Edge (Latest)
- IE (9+)
- Opera (Latest)
- Safari (Latest)
- Vivaldi (Latest)
- Epiphany (Latest)
